AI‐Directed 3D Printing of Hierarchical Polyurethane Foams
Digitally guided direct ink writing, combined with AI‐generated design, enables the fabrication of hierarchical polyurethane foams with tunable multiscale porosity. This approach produces architected foams featuring interconnected open‐cell networks and tailored mechanical properties, advancing the development of adaptive, high‐performance materials ...

The Microbiota Shapes Central Nervous System Myelination in Early Life
Gut microbiota shapes brain development by regulating myelination and glial cell maturation in early life. Using germ‐free (GF) mice and zebrafish, this study reveals sex‐ and age‐dependent effects on myelin growth, integrity, and related gene expression.
